    Complete Buying Guide for Best 3 Person Tent For Backpacking

    Essential Factors We Consider

    When selecting the best 3 person tent for backpacking, we focus on key features that truly matter for the trail. Weight is paramount; a lighter tent means a more enjoyable hike. We look for durable, waterproof, and wind-resistant materials that can withstand varying weather conditions. Ease of setup is also crucial – you want to spend more time exploring and less time wrestling with poles. Finally, interior space and ventilation are vital for comfort, especially after a long day of trekking. A well-designed tent offers enough room to sleep comfortably and breathe fresh air.

    Budget Planning

    Backpacking tents can range significantly in price, and it’s important to find one that fits your budget without compromising too much on essential features. While ultralight, high-performance tents often come with a premium price tag, there are excellent budget-friendly options available, as seen with some of our selections. Consider how often you’ll be backpacking and the types of conditions you’ll encounter. For occasional trips, a more affordable option might suffice, while frequent and demanding adventures may warrant a higher investment. Remember to factor in the cost of accessories like a footprint or stakes if they aren’t included.

    Frequently Asked Questions

    Q: What is the average weight for a good 3 person backpacking tent?

    A: A good 3 person backpacking tent typically weighs between 4 to 6 pounds. However, ultralight models can go as low as 3 pounds, while more budget-friendly or feature-rich options might creep up to 7 pounds or more. The key is to balance weight with durability and space for your needs.

    Q: Can a 3 person tent comfortably fit three adults?

    A: While labeled as 3 person tents, many can feel snug for three adults, especially with gear. If you prefer more space or plan to bring a lot of equipment, consider a tent rated for one person more than you need, or look for models with generous interior dimensions and ample vestibule space. This is why looking at best backpacking tent for 3 person reviews is helpful.

    Q: Are double-wall tents better for backpacking than single-wall tents?

    A: Double-wall tents (with an inner tent and a separate rainfly) generally offer better ventilation and reduce condensation compared to single-wall tents. This makes them a preferred choice for most backpacking conditions, especially in humid or variable weather. Single-wall tents are often lighter but can be more prone to condensation issues.

    Q: How important is the waterproof rating (hydrostatic head) for a backpacking tent?

    A: The waterproof rating, often measured by hydrostatic head (HH), is very important. For a backpacking tent’s rainfly and floor, a rating of 1500mm HH is generally considered good. Higher ratings, like 3000mm HH and above, offer superior protection against heavy rain and prolonged wet conditions, which is crucial for staying dry on multi-day trips.
